Senior Business Developer

Purpose of position

We are looking for a motivated individual who will excel in developing new business opportunities with leading brands in the North American market.

Working in the New Business department, this role offers the successful candidate the opportunity of joining a dynamic US sales team in a leading global digital marketing network. The individual will be responsible for building new relationships/partnerships with blue chip companies and digital agencies in North America, while maximizing upsell opportunities and network revenue. 

Key Tasks

Key responsibilities within this role include:
  • Develop & maintain a North American prospect/brand sales pipeline, using salesforce CRM system for pipeline management
  • Fulfilling all aspects of successful sales cycles (RFI’s, RFP’s, quotes, presentations, reporting, and contracts)
  • Achieve 75 outbound calls/emails per week
  • Conduct 8 meetings with prospects per month
  • Closing business on a monthly basis, delivering and surpassing monthly/quarterly targets
  • Educate new prospects about Awin, our market position, technology and the North American market
  • Renegotiating contracts with existing clients
  • Adopting a consultative & mature approach, engaging with senior decision-makers about strategic market trends, industry progression and online developments
  • Monitor and report on market and competitor activities and provide relevant reports and information to the team
  • Manage the transition of new advertiser accounts through finance, technical and account development teams for launch onto the network
  • Establish and maintain effective working relationships with co-workers, managers and customers
  • Pursue personal development of skills and knowledge necessary for the effective performance of the role

Skills & Expertise

  • 5 years + business development experience, including 2+ years of either digital or SAAS sales
  • Proven sales background, securing high revenue business from Internet Retailer Top 1,000 companies
  • Excellent negotiation skills
  • Self-motivation, ambition and initiative
  • Ability to work in a fast-paced, competitive and dynamic environment
  • Strong communication skills (both verbal and written), including experience of C-Level presentations  
  • Ability to work effectively as part of a nationwide and international team
  • High degree of resilience and persuasiveness
  • Excellent computer literacy including all MS Office applications

Part of the Axel Springer and United Internet Groups, Awin is a global affiliate network. With ShareASale and affilinet, the Awin group is comprised of 15 offices worldwide, 1,000 employees, 100,000 contributing publishers and 13,000 advertisers, connecting customers with brands in over 180 countries around the globe. Operating across the retail, telecommunications, travel and finance verticals, Awin generated €13.6 billion in revenue for its advertisers and €607 million for its publishers in the last financial year.
If you are interested in joining Awin please apply online.
Apply now
Your browser is out of date!

Update your browser to view this website correctly. Update my browser now

×